- 博客(67)
- 收藏
- 关注
原创 ie无法直接打开xml 文件的解决方法:
ie无法直接打开xml 文件的解决方法:安装DW8的时候不要选中默认用DW8打开xml和xslt文件或者把dw8删除
2007-01-10 13:22:00
2592
原创 win32消息系统
win32消息系统using System.Runtime.InteropServices ; [DllImport("user32")] static extern int SendMessage(IntPtr hWnd, uint Msg, uint wParam, uint lParam); [DllImport("user32.dll")]
2007-01-10 13:22:00
842
原创 自定义索引器
自定义索引器/// /// displayinfoarry 的摘要说明/// public class displayinfoarry{ ArrayList temparr = new ArrayList(); public void arradd(displayinfo displayinfo) { temparr.Add(displayinfo); }
2007-01-10 13:19:00
693
原创 Javascript 获得页面的宽度和高度等!
Javascript 获得页面的宽度和高度等! var s = "";s += "/r/n网页可见区域宽:"+ document.body.clientWidth;s += "/r/n网页可见区域高:"+ document.body.clientHeight;s += "/r/n网页可见区域宽:"+ document.body.offs
2007-01-10 13:18:00
697
原创 调试datatable
/// /// 自己写的调试datatable /// /// private void debugoutput(DataTable text) { int defaultrowwidth = 40; string thisrow1 = ""; for (int c = 0; c {
2007-01-10 13:17:00
819
原创 捕获js textbox键盘事件
捕获js textbox键盘事件document.all["t1"].onkeydown=function(){alert(String.fromCharCode(event.keyCode) )}
2007-01-10 13:16:00
1125
原创 用dom解读xml的时候,如果碰到有命名空间的时候(就是节点名字有:的时候)需要把xml文件中的那个命名空间地址和名字拿出来加到XmlNamespaceManager 里面去
用dom解读xml的时候,如果碰到有命名空间的时候(就是节点名字有:的时候)需要把xml文件中的那个命名空间地址和名字拿出来加到XmlNamespaceManager 里面去 XmlDocument dom = new XmlDocument(); dom.LoadXml(getresponse()); XmlNamespaceManager nsman
2007-01-10 13:16:00
1239
原创 让webservice测试页面支持Get方法
让webservice测试页面支持Get方法修改/Microsoft.NET/Framework/{version}/CONFIG/web.config在 添加
2007-01-10 13:15:00
1022
原创 直接读取文件,和直接排序
直接读取文件,和直接排序 string[] temp = File.ReadAllLines(Server.MapPath("~/App_Data/WordData.txt")); Array.Sort(temp, new CaseInsensitiveComparer()); // sort for binary search
2007-01-10 13:14:00
673
原创 c# datetime转换
c# datetime转换:(.tostring(yyyy-MM-dd hh:mm:ss) 可以随意组合) using System; using System.Globalization; public class MainClass { public static void Main(string[] args) { DateTime dt = DateTime.N
2007-01-10 13:13:00
1116
原创 在.net中实现与ASP完全兼容的MD5算法(包括中文字符)
在.net中实现与ASP完全兼容的MD5算法(包括中文字符) 在.net中,由于.net framework 封装了常见的加密算法,因此实现标准的MD5算法只需要短短几行代码即可实现: public string Md5(string strPassword) { MD5CryptoServiceProvider hashmd5; hashmd5 = new MD5Crypt
2007-01-10 13:12:00
650
原创 冒泡排序法
冒泡 public static string[] BubbleSort(string[] R) { /// /// 冒泡排序法 /// int i, j; //交换标志 string temp; bool exchange; for (i = 0; i {
2007-01-10 13:12:00
705
原创 复制datatable结构,复制datatable结构和数据
c#复制datatable结构.clone()复制datatable结构和数据.copy()DataTable.select("name like %abc%")DataTable.select("name =abc")DataTable.select("name >abc")
2007-01-10 13:10:00
3069
原创 vs2005调试js
vs2005调试js在ie的internet选项-高级里面把禁止调试脚本的钩去掉,把集成window 身分验证的钩打上vs里面调试->窗口-〉脚本资源管理器,在里面选好要调试的文件就能设置断点了
2007-01-10 13:09:00
991
原创 调试窗口输出(输出窗口),通常用来监视线程的时间
//调试窗口输出(输出窗口),通常用来监视线程的时间System.Diagnostics.Debug.WriteLine("tr2" + DateTime.Now.ToString())
2007-01-10 13:09:00
499
原创 c#实现escape编码
c#实现escape编码:(用在ajax中)然后在aspx用unescape解码,就不会出现乱码问题 private string escape(string s) { StringBuilder sb = new StringBuilder(); byte[] ba = System.Text.Encoding.Unicode.GetBytes(s);
2007-01-10 13:07:00
1956
原创 用Javascript实现完美关闭窗口
用Javascript实现完美关闭窗口 function CloseWin(){var ua=navigator.userAgentvar ie=navigator.appName=="Microsoft Internet Explorer"?true:falseif(ie){ var Ieversion=parseFloat(ua.substring(ua.indexOf("MSIE ")
2007-01-10 13:05:00
502
原创 取得请求者的IP地址,取得本地ip
取得请求者的IP地址1. ip=Request.ServerVariables["REMOTE_HOST"];2. return HttpContext.Current.Request.UserHostAddress;取得本地ipSystem.Net.IPAddress addr; addr = new System.Net.IPAddress(System.Net.Dns.GetHo
2007-01-10 13:04:00
1052
原创 js:取得单选按钮的值
js:取得单选按钮的值function aa(){for(i=0;i{if(document.all[radiobutton][i].checked){window.alert(document.all[radiobutton][i].value);}}}js:帮单选设置选中项document.all[radiobutton][1].checked=true
2007-01-10 13:03:00
1506
原创 javascript 数组
js:javascript 数组var aa=new Array();aa[0]=........初值:var array1 = new Array("a", "b", "c");
2007-01-10 13:03:00
371
原创 js:遍历容器中的元素
js:遍历容器中的元素 XXXXXX var containerid=document.all["controls"]; var ids=containerid.getElementsByTagName("input"); var i; for(i=0;i { if(ids.item(i).id.substring(0,30)=="ctl00_ContentPlaceHolder1_txti")
2007-01-10 13:02:00
1663
原创 c#读取文本文件这个文件的编码一定要utf-8的
c#读取文本文件这个文件的编码一定要utf-8的 StreamReader sr1 = File.OpenText(Server.MapPath(".")+@"/App_Code/weathercity.txt"); while (sr1.Peek() >= 0) { Console.Wri
2007-01-10 13:00:00
1548
原创 png图片作为td背景的时候让png 的背景透明
png图片作为td背景的时候让png 的背景透明(style属性里的路径需要修改)(在这种td里的连接需要加上 position:relative的style不然会失效) 放在head里面(新)function correctPNG() { for(var i=0; i { var img = document.images[i] var imgName
2007-01-10 12:59:00
1050
原创 webservice远程调试
//-----------------------webservice远程调试-------------------------http://schemas.microsoft.com/.NetConfiguration/v2.0">
2007-01-10 12:57:00
673
原创 c#域名转ip
c#域名转ip MessageBox.Show(Dns.Resolve("www.baidu.com").AddressList[0].ToString());
2007-01-10 12:56:00
636
原创 允许不同线程调用同一个控件
允许不同线程调用同一个控件Control.CheckForIllegalCrossThreadCalls = false;//原据照抄,放在form_load里
2007-01-10 12:55:00
705
原创 js刷新页面,aspx刷新页面
js刷新页面location.reload()和history.go(0)不过后者有个好处,能保持页面滚动条的位置。(IE中测试过)//------------------------------aspx刷新页面private void Button1_Click(object sender, System.EventArgs e) { Response.Redirect(Reque
2007-01-10 12:54:00
1204
原创 C#中的RichTextBox怎样将光标自动跳转到指定的位置呢?
C#中的RichTextBox怎样将光标自动跳转到指定的位置呢?richTextBox1.Select(6, 0);
2007-01-10 12:54:00
3715
原创 c#多线程
c#多线程using System.Threading;public Thread tr1;上面是定义tr1=new Thread(new ThreadStart(函数));//函数不要括号tr1.Start();上面是启动tr1.Abort(); Thread.Sleep(200);退出与延时//-线程带参数-------------------------------------
2007-01-10 12:53:00
374
原创 当你希望从ashx或HttpHandler里访问你的Session时,你必须实现IReadOnlySessionState接口.
当你希望从ashx或HttpHandler里访问你的Session时,你必须实现IReadOnlySessionState接口.代码:using System;using System.Web;using System.Web.SessionState;public class DownloadHandler : IHttpHandler, IReadOnlySessionState{
2007-01-10 12:52:00
1268
1
原创 css背景透明可用于img,td table
css背景透明可用于img,td tablestyle="filter: Alpha(Opacity=50);"
2007-01-10 12:51:00
1581
原创 .net md5加密
md5加密 public string md5(string str) {return System.Web.Security.FormsAuthentication.HashPasswordForStoringInConfigFile(str,"MD5").ToUpper();}
2007-01-10 12:50:00
658
原创 asp.net 接收post过来的东西
接收post过来的东西Stream resStream = Request.InputStream; //根据上面定义的数据流,以默认编码的方式定义一个读数据流 StreamReader sr = new StreamReader(resStream, System.Text.Encoding.Default); Response.Write(sr.ReadToEnd());
2007-01-10 12:49:00
1206
1
原创 取得汉字拼音首字母
//-----------------取得汉字拼音首字母---------用getSpells(string input) public string getSpells(string input) { int len = input.Length; string reVal = ""; for(int i=0;i { reVal += getSpell(input.Sub
2007-01-10 12:48:00
405
原创 window.open 参数介绍
window.open 参数介绍toolbar=yes,no 是否显示工具条location=yes,no 是否显示网址栏directories=yes,no 是否显示导航条status=yes,no 是否显示状态条menubar=yes,no 是否显示菜单scrollbars=yes,no 是否显示滚动条resizable=yes,no 是否可以改变公告窗口大小copyhistory=yes
2007-01-10 12:47:00
484
原创 如何让iframe的背景透明
如何让iframe的背景透明 在被iframe的叶面里iframe里allowTransparency="true"
2007-01-10 12:46:00
286
原创 取得网页源代码
取得网页源代码private void BtnWebRequest_Click(object sender, System.EventArgs e) { PageUrl = UrlText.Text; //根据指定的UR建立WEB请求 WebRequest request = WebRequest.Create(PageUrl); //定义对上面WEB请求的反应 WebRe
2007-01-10 12:46:00
396
原创 内部启动进程(dos)
内部启动进程 Process p = new Process(); p.StartInfo.FileName = "cmd "; p.StartInfo.Arguments = "/C ping 127.0.0.1 "; p.StartInfo.UseShellExecute = false;
2007-01-10 12:45:00
666
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人